IMHO, I think FarCry is going to be a mass sleeper hit. Ive been keeping my eye on it for awhile now, and talked with some of the dev's about the engine (needed info for my teams mod, etc) and I believe its going to be simply amazing.

With the massive outdoor enviroments with seamless transitions to indoors, over 1KM+ view ranges, vehicles, etc. the game will probably be pushing alot of higher end machines when its set to the highest detail.

Some of the key features that really interest me are:

1. Massive view distances, talking over 1K with rumored support of up to over 5K.
2. Graphics, gotta have the great graphics.
3. Editor, their motto for it is "What you see is what you get" You can literally make a bunch of changes in the editor, press a key. Instantly be in the game (from within the editor), try out your stuff. Press another key, be back in the editor to tweak then do it all over again.
4. Physics system they developed are looking incredibly impressive (ragdoll, vehicle physics, etc)
5. Lighting in the game is superb. Can shoot a light fixture and watch it swing around affect the room. Supposedly can shoot holes through thinner objects and see the beams of light shining through as well. New way to peek into a room before ya go in... shoot a hole in the wall and look for yourself lol.
6. AI, non scripted, reactive characters that make each run through of the game a different experience depending on how you play it. Enemys will find cover, flank, call in reinforments, track you down, etc. Stuff is really impressive.

Just a few of the things I like about it. But enough ranting, check it out for yourself at farcry-thegame.com
